Finest Roof Materials
When thinking about putting up a house or a business structure, it is essential to take into account the quality of roofing products to use and its resilience, apart from its aesthetic worth and design. A good quality however inexpensive roof is what most of us would like to have for our new homes. What are a couple of popular and finest roof products?
A roofing system may be comprised of structure shingles, wood shakes, clay tile, slate, concrete tile, and metal roofings. Shingles include fiberglass and paper, protected with asphalt, and is covered with colored granules. This is probably the one of the frequently utilized and the least costly roofing material. A composition shingle, commercially readily available, usually weighs around 200 to 350 lbs. Due to the fact that this kind of roofing material can be easily utilized in various applications, it may not necessarily need a professional to do the roofing job; you may do the setup yourself given that this can simply be nailed over an existing roofing system.
opt for an appearance of design for your house, wood shakes may be an alternative. The best wood shakes are that of an old cedar tree. While this might give a visual appearance, it does not account for long-lasting worth and toughness due to the fact that its composition is prone to molds, unwanted termites, and it could even rot in the long run. It permits a cooler and a more insulated result when it comes to ventilation.
This is due to its significantly heavy weight and the fragility of the material. Home and other building constructions that utilize concrete tiles require to have a well-supported structure to keep the tiles in location for quite sometime.
fashionable and elegant houses is slate. It appears like shingles but in a rock composition, and it can be as heavy as a concrete tile. Like tiles, it needs a strong structure for it to be nailed in location. Both tiles and slate are excellent choice for toughness and endurance. Likewise, they require less upkeep as compared to wood shakes.
Finally, an apparently ending up being more widely used roofing product nowadays is metal roof. practically see them on homes nearly all over since of its tested toughness and long-lasting worth. It does not get consumed by fire and is quite maintenance-free. This is fairly light compared to the rest of the roof materials when it comes to weight.

Flat Roofs
Flat roofings are a terrific method to keep a structure safe from water. Knowing exactly what to do with a flat roofing will guarantee you have a working roof system that will last a long time.
They may look good, and are really typical, flat roofing systems do need regular maintenance and comprehensive repair in order to efficiently prevent water infiltration. correctly, you'll enjoy with your flat roofing for a very long time.
Flat roofing systems aren't as popular and/or attractive as its newer counterparts, such as slate, copper, or tile roofs. However, they are just as crucial and require much more attention. In order to prevent getting rid of money on short-term repair work, you need to know exactly how flat roof systems are designed, the different types of flat roofing systems that are available, and the value of routine inspection and upkeep.
A flat roofing system works by supplying a waterproof membrane over a building. It consists of one or more layers of hydrophobic products that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is generally placed between roofing memb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of material such as copper, converge with the membrane and the other building components to avoid water seepage.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and seamless gutters by the roofing's slight pitch.
There are 4 most typical types of flat roof systems. Listed in order of increasing durability and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can vary an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is used over and existing roofing,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ofs.
Used since the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ing usually includes one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are used over roofing system fel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and normally covered with a granular mineral surface. The seams are usually covered over with a roofing substance.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roofing is the latest kind of roofing product. It is typically utilized to replace multiple-ply roofings. 10 to 12 year guarantees are normal, but appropriate installation is important and maintenance is still needed.
Multiple-ply or built-up roofing, also known as BUR, is made of overlapping rolls of saturated or coated fel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and surfaced with a granular roof sheet, ballast, or tile pavers that are used to secure the underlying materials from the weather condition. BURs are developed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the products utilized.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a coating of asphalt or coal tar. Because the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es checking and maintaining the joints of the roofing hard.
Lastly, flat-seamed roofs have been used since the 19 th century. Made from small p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last many years depending upon the quality of the upkeep, direct exposure, and product to the elements.
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to avoid rust and split seams need to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and generally requires changing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are preferred as lasting flat roofing systems.
